源码网商城,靠谱的源码在线交易网站 我的订单 购物车 帮助

源码网商城

JavaScript获取伪元素(Pseudo-Element)属性的方法技巧

  • 时间:2020-04-20 11:28 编辑: 来源: 阅读:
  • 扫一扫,手机访问
摘要:JavaScript获取伪元素(Pseudo-Element)属性的方法技巧
CSS伪元素(pseudo-elements)非常的有用——你可以用它制作出CSS三角形,用在提示框上面,还可以用它完成很多简单的任务,而不需要多余的HTML元素。以前,伪元素的CSS属性是无法用JavaScript获取的,但现在,有了一个新的JavaScript方法可以访问它们! 假设你的CSS代码是这样的:
[u]复制代码[/u] 代码如下:
.element:before {  content: 'NEW';  color: rgb(255, 0, 0); }
为了获取.element:before里的样式属性,你可以使用下面的JavaScript代码:
[u]复制代码[/u] 代码如下:
var color = window.getComputedStyle(  document.querySelector('.element'), ':before' ).getPropertyValue('color')
将伪元素作为window.getComputedStyle方法的第二个参数,你能获取到伪元素样式里的属性!将这个技巧放入你的知识库里,随着浏览器的发展,伪元素将会变得越来越有用!
  • 全部评论(0)
联系客服
客服电话:
400-000-3129
微信版

扫一扫进微信版
返回顶部